Here's when Nottingham Castle is expected to reopen after £30m redevelopment

It is one of the biggest changes to happen to the city centre landmark in decades. At a cost of a cool £30m, the redevelopment of Nottingham Castle has been underway since the summer of 2018.

The plan is to create 'a world-class visitor destination' adding new attractions and major updates of the Castle and grounds, to reflect its 1,000 years of history,

So when will it reopen to the public?

There is no set date as yet, no grand re-opening party to stick in your diary. While work is expected to be complete by the end of 2020, it won't be open to the public until early 2021.

The initial plan was for it to be open again by the summer of 2020 but various factors have pushed the date back. Richard Oldfield, project manager for G F Tomlinson, the company leading to transformation, said: "Throughout the project we have encountered a number of unknown factors ranging from the uncovering of rotten timbers, the failure of masonry and the discovery of unexpected archaeology."

What changes are being made?

- a new visitor centre at the entrance

- access to more caves beneath the Castle

- a Robin Hood gallery which will "bring to life the adventurous tales of the city's legendary outlaw"

-  a new outdoor adventure play area located in the Castle Ditch

- restoration of the roof

- virtual-reality experiences

- a stained-glass window made in 1878 will be reinstated in the cafe

- more talks and events from artists, including theatre and music
